About 4-N-[[1-(dimethylamino)cyclobutyl]methyl]-4-N-methyl-6-N-propylpyrimidine-4,6-diamine
4-N-[[1-(dimethylamino)cyclobutyl]methyl]-4-N-methyl-6-N-propylpyrimidine-4,6-diamine (PubChem CID 105420977) has the molecular formula C15H27N5
and a molecular weight of 277.42 g/mol. Its IUPAC name is 4-N-[[1-(dimethylamino)cyclobutyl]methyl]-4-N-methyl-6-N-propylpyrimidine-4,6-diamine.

What is the SMILES notation for 4-N-[[1-(dimethylamino)cyclobutyl]methyl]-4-N-methyl-6-N-propylpyrimidine-4,6-diamine?
The canonical SMILES for 4-N-[[1-(dimethylamino)cyclobutyl]methyl]-4-N-methyl-6-N-propylpyrimidine-4,6-diamine is CCCNc1cc(N(C)CC2(N(C)C)CCC2)ncn1.
What is the InChIKey of 4-N-[[1-(dimethylamino)cyclobutyl]methyl]-4-N-methyl-6-N-propylpyrimidine-4,6-diamine?
The InChIKey is ABVCEOIHYUTRHD-UHFFFAOYSA-N. The full InChI is InChI=1S/C15H27N5/c1-5-9-16-13-10-14(18-12-17-13)20(4)11-15(19(2)3)7-6-8-15/h10,12H,5-9,11H2,1-4H3,(H,16,17,18).
What are the key properties of 4-N-[[1-(dimethylamino)cyclobutyl]methyl]-4-N-methyl-6-N-propylpyrimidine-4,6-diamine?
4-N-[[1-(dimethylamino)cyclobutyl]methyl]-4-N-methyl-6-N-propylpyrimidine-4,6-diamine has a molecular weight of 277.42 g/mol, XLogP of 2.22, 7 rotatable bonds, 1 hydrogen bond donors, and 5 hydrogen bond acceptors.
